MacIntyre Academies Trust opened its first academy, in Headington, Oxford in September 2014. Endeavour Academy is an Academy School for children and young people with autism and associated severe Learning Difficulties aged from 8 to 19 years old. MacIntyre Academies is sponsored by MacIntyre Charity, which over the last 50 years, has developed a strong reputation nationally, as a high-quality, person-centred organisation. 

The Role 

We are currently recruiting for an inspirational and creative Class Teacher to join this exciting school, this a really exciting opportunity to be part of something very special which has just completed its second year. Reporting to the Assistant Principal you will be responsible for the delivery of teaching and learning within the range of key stages 3, 4 and post 16, whilst looking for continuous improvement by monitoring and assessing the achievement of our young people. You will line manage teaching support staff and provide effective communication and guidance surrounding lesson requirements. You will also work closely with colleagues in the residential provision, Endeavour House to ensure delivery and commitment to the Waking Day curriculum. You will also work closely with internal and external stakeholders to successfully deliver the vision, ethos, aims and objectives of the academy. This will enable successful learning and achievement by young people and sustained improvement in their spiritual, moral, social, cultural, mental and physical well-being in preparation for the opportunities, responsibilities and experiences of adult life. 

About You 

You will need to be an exceptional classroom practitioner, hold QTS and have demonstrable experience of working with Children and Young people with Autism, associated challenging behaviour and other complex needs. You will be able to implement strategies for raising achievement and have knowledge of working with accreditation boards such as ASDAN and AQA and be committed to your further professional development.
